Job Description



The Job Mission

This role supports the electrical design of a major power plant project

You’ll help produce and manage cable routing deliverables

You’ll contribute to the design review and technical coordination



Your responsibilities include:



Support development of cable routing layouts using in-house tools

Prepare routing reports ensuring cable paths and lengths are accurate

Assist in assessing feasibility of design changes or queries raised

Collaborate with the layout team to resolve routing challenges

Participate in risk assessments and propose routing optimisations

Provide feedback to improve routing software and its usage

Attend team meetings to report progress and identify key issues

Take part in training sessions and knowledge-sharing initiatives. 



Qualifications



Essential Skills



Degree in Electrical Engineering or equivalent

Experience with cable sizing, routing, and sequencing

Familiar with CAD software

Able to review and contribute to electrical design documentation

Confident working with 3D models and digital routing tools

Strong organisational skills to manage design tasks

Effective communicator, both verbal and written

Comfortable collaborating across multidisciplinary teams 



Desired Skills



Exposure to AVEVA E3D or Navisworks

Exposure to Caneco or similar tools

Experience working in a regulated or large-scale infrastructure project

Basic understanding of I&C system layout
